We made use of Obamacare when I was between teacher retirement and Medicare.

Since insurance changes so drastically each year, my information may not still be viable.

 

In the case of a friend, who has her own business, this is what happened: her DH was in a bad auto-accident.

They had no insurance because it was cost-prohibitive.

 

While her DH was in the hospital, someone came into the room and offered to sign their family up for insurance through the marketplace.

 

The marketplace is the site you go to in order to sign up for Obamacare. In our case, the premiums we paid were based on my total yearly income (which meant low because I had retired - no income.)

My son had a different experience in Pennsylvania. He had a psychotic episode from some medicine. He is in his 40s and had no job. We called the paramedics and he was admitted to the psych floor. The social worker called me even though it was 1 AM and immediatly began the process of getting him Medicaid. He was accepted and his bills were covered and he had medical and dental coverage. His episode was not considered a disability because it was a reaction to something. It cleared his system in two days and he was released. I think the best thing to do is contact social workers at a hospital to find out how Medicaid works in your state.
